  • The Urban Decay Naked 2 Palette for Brown Smokey Eyes

    The Urban Decay Naked 2 Palette for Brown Smokey Eyes

    NAKED 2 eyeshadow palette

    I was lucky enough to be treated with many of the presents on my Christmas wish list this year, including this gorgeous Urban Decay Naked 2 eyeshadow palette. This is an eyeshadow palette I’ve had my eyes on for quite some time (no pun intended). If I’m honest I was torn between all three of the Naked palettes (they also do a 1 and 3) so didn’t really mind which one I got but I was truly delighted when I received this one as a gift on Christmas Day.

    Urban Decay Naked 2

    What’s so good about it? I hear you say. Well I’m sure many of you may have heard of the famous Naked palettes but for those of you who haven’t, aside for the fact that the product and packaging itself looks gorgeous, the eyeshadow shades inside are stunning too. The palette comprises of twelve fabulous neutral, beige and deep brown shades in a mixture of shimmery and matte. There is also one black eyeshadow which is perfect for completing that smokey eye look. The palette also includes a double ended brush and large mirror, making it perfect for your travels too.

    Naked 2 palette

    I’d say if you were going to own only one eyeshadow palette, then make it this. It literally has every shade you would need to create day and night looks in neutral and brown tones.

    Naked 2 eyeshadow

    I also think this palette is a great one for on holiday or during the summer months, as it has those gorgeous shimmery golden shades which look great with a tan.

    Urban Decay eyeshadow

    Best eyeshadow palette

    Urban Decay Eyeshadow Primer Potion

    Inside my Naked 2 palette also came this sample of the Urban Decay Eyeshadow Primer Potion. You can use it to prep the eyelids before applying your eyeshadow so that it stays on and lasts longer. So far I’ve been trying out the original primer potion and I really like it. You only need to use a small amount at a time, so I reckon if you were to buy the regular sized tube that it would last for quite a while. It seems to do a good job of setting the eyeshadow too and keeping it on for longer.

  • My Skincare routine – How I Help Prevent and Cover Spots and Pimples

    My Skincare routine – How I Help Prevent and Cover Spots and Pimples

    I’ve been asked on numerous occasions about my skin care routine and due to lengthy detailing that it consists of I have to admit I’ve always been a little bit lazy when it came to writing this blog post. Anyway, it was after writing a lengthy explanation of my skin care routine to a friend of a friend that I realised I’d basically written my long over due blog post in the process. So after some slight grammatical corrections and minor edits I’d thought I’d finally share it with you all…

    The best thing I use for my skin is my face sauna. I use the No7 one. I’ve had mine for a number of years, it’s literally so old it has cracks down the side, so I should probably invest in a new one but for the time being it still works a treat… After checking online it appears that they don’t seem to do the No7 any more but here’s a similar one that I found sold at Argos: MySpa Facial Sauna.

    I usually use my face sauna once a week and steam my face. For me it feels like it helps sweat out all the bad stuff as gross as that sounds. After I’ve done a face sauna I’ll usually do a face mask. I really like the Clearasil or Neutrogena ones. Again I usually buy these from Boots/Superdrug. I personally like the ones that set hard on the skin and then you you wash off after a bit of time. For example I like Clearasil blemish + marks wash and mask mentioned in this previous post here. More recently I’ve been using The Body Shops honey and oat mask which I love. It’s not as harsh as the Clearasil one so may be better if you have sensitive skin. I do like to sometimes use the Clearasil one as after using it, it has a similar feeling to that you get after you’ve brushed your teeth but on your face. Basically it feels really fresh and clean.

    Clearasil Blemis & Marks Face Wash and Mask

    The Body Shop HONEY & OAT 3 IN 1 SCRUB MASK

    So when I’ve done my sauna followed by my face mask of choice, I like to use Boots Tea Tree & Witch Hazel Night Gel (a bit of a reoccurring theme here, I shop a lot in Boots if you hadn’t already guessed). I feel like it works as a good antiseptic to prevent spots after steaming your face and opening the pores. If my skin is feeling particularly dry I’ll add a light moisturiser over the top after the Tea Tree but otherwise I’ll use it alone.

    Day to day I too like to use a face scrub. I like the St Ives Invigorating Apricot Facial Scrub. It’s one I regularly use and I feel it works well to gently exfoliate the skin and keep it feeling soft and looking clear.

    I also find the removal of makeup a big part of my skincare routine, especially when it comes to preventing spots. To remove makeup I find using a cleanser rather than makeup wipe helps to prevent pimples. I do occasionally use makeup wipes when I’m away from home or on the go but I feel like my skin is left feeling cleaner when I use something else. I really like the Garnier Micellar Cleansing Water to remove makeup. It’s exactly like Bioderma’s Sensibio H2O – Micelle Solution (if you’ve used that) but loads cheaper. Then I like to use a light facial wash on my face before moisturising.

    Garnier Cleansing Water

    My current daytime moisturiser is No7 Essential Moisture Day Cream and my current nighttime moisturiser is Superdrug’s Natually Radiant renewing night cream. Although I don’t like to use that one all the time as it can be a little oily.

    No7 Essential Moisture Day Cream

    Naturally Radiant Renewing Night Cream

    If you’re worried about covering spots or blemishes, the foundation that I’ve found to have the best coverage is Illamasqua’s Skin Base. They sell it in Selfridges or Debenhams and they can match your tone for you. If you live abroad you can also order from Illamasqua online and I’d say to anyone wondering that this foundation is definitely worth the investment. It lasts ages and I personally like this one for nights out when I want a flawless look. I use Skin Base shade 12.

    Illamasqua Skin Base Foundation

    On a shoot the other day I also discovered Bobbi Brown’s BB cream. Obviously this isn’t one for extreme coverage as its only a bb cream but it’s good for when you feel you want less on the skin as its super light and as its a BBcream it’s good on the skin.   • LVL Lashes

    LVL Lashes

    It was a while ago when I first heard about LVL Lashes. I had seen a few pictures on social media, thought they looked good but didn’t know much about it and so I eventually forgot all about them, until not long ago. Jade, who has recently qualified in doing LVL Lashes got in touch with me and asked if I’d like to try them out. I wasn’t sure what they were but as I’d seen good results online, I was curious and so agreed to have them done.

    After a 24 hour patch test, I was good to go and so I went round to Jade’s, who does the salon standard procedure from home. The entire treatment takes around 45 minutes and is completely painless and irritation free. I was comfortably lay down on a beauty bed whilst the LVL lash treatment was done with eyes closed for the most part. Jade then carefully carried out each part of the treatment and less than an hour later I had fabulous, longer looking lashes, without the hassle of mascara or extensions.

    So what are LVL Lashes? I hear you say… First of all LVL itself stands for lengthen, volume, lift. The treatment achieves longer and lifted lashes without the use of glue or extensions. The treatment is said to straighten and lift the lashes before also adding a tint to create fuller and more defined lashes which lasts up to 6 to 10 weeks.

    After the first 24 hours it is advised that you do not wet the lashes, rub or apply mascara to them. This was actually much easier than it sounds. I managed to wash and cleanse my face whilst avoiding the eye area and the fact that I couldn’t apply mascara didn’t matter, as my lashes looked great anyway.

    Below you can see the pictures taken immediately before and after the LVL Lash Treatment:
    LVL Lashes Before and After

    As you can see, the results were immediate and I was so impressed with how my lashes looked, mascara free! I’d never had my lashes tinted before as I already have very dark hair, so thought it unnecessary. However I can certainly see the difference that the tint makes to my lashes, along with the lifting treatment that helped make my lashes appear much longer than they are.

    I went away feeling more than happy with the results and I was also given an LVL serum, to use on my lashes. The LVL Serum (which I forgot to photograph) is a clear gel type product which comes is a mascara type tube with a lash wand. The LVL Serum is to be used morning and night, simply to condition the lashes and keep them looking healthy. I’ve been using the LVL Lash Serum for over a week and a half now (starting not long after the LVL Lash treatment itself) and my lashes have never looked better.

    Since having the LVL lash treatment, I’ve been enjoying the comfort of going mascara free. However, on days when I want those extra long lashes, I’ve added mascara for an even bigger ‘wow’ look. Here are my eyelashes a week after having the LVL Lash treatment, with mascara on:
